Course Overview
Why This Course
As industrial processes grow more complex and digitally integrated, the need for robust, data-driven hazard and operability studies (HAZOP) has never been greater. Modern safety management demands not only technical expertise but also efficiency, collaboration, and innovation in hazard identification and risk assessment.
The Advanced HAZOP Methodologies and Digital Applications course provides an in-depth, practical exploration of advanced HAZOP concepts and tools. Over 5 intensive days, participants will learn to design, facilitate, and optimize HAZOP studies using modern approaches, digital platforms, and integrated risk management frameworks.
Through a blend of case studies, interactive exercises, and real-world simulations, participants will develop the skills to lead effective HAZOP sessions and drive safety excellence across industrial operations.

The Program Flow
Day 1: Foundations of Modern HAZOP
- Evolution and modernization of HAZOP methodology.
- Fundamentals of risk assessment and process hazard analysis.
- Role of HAZOP within Process Safety Management (PSM) systems.
- Introduction to digital tools and their impact on HAZOP workflows.
- Case study: Comparing traditional vs. digital HAZOP processes.
Day 2: Advanced HAZOP Techniques
- Expanding guidewords and applying innovative analysis techniques.
- Approaches for handling complex and integrated system scenarios.
- Incorporating human factors and operational behaviors into HAZOP studies.
- Scenario-based and dynamic HAZOP techniques for evolving systems.
- Workshop: Applying advanced guidewords to complex process situations.
Day 3: Digital Tools and HAZOP
- Overview of leading HAZOP software solutions and platforms.
- Managing data flow and digital documentation in HAZOP projects.
- Real-time collaboration tools for distributed and hybrid teams.
- Practical session: Conducting a digital HAZOP simulation.
- Best practices for database management and audit trail maintenance.
Day 4: HAZOP Team Dynamics and Leadership
- Structuring an effective multidisciplinary HAZOP team.
- Leadership skills for HAZOP facilitators and team members.
- Managing divergent views, conflicts, and achieving consensus.
- Remote and hybrid facilitation strategies for global projects.
- Exercise: Facilitating a mock HAZOP session with role-based participation.
Day 5: HAZOP Integration and Best Practices
- Integrating HAZOP with other risk assessment methodologies (LOPA, SIL, FMEA).
- Sector-specific HAZOP applications (Oil & Gas, Chemicals, Power).
- Navigating industry regulations, compliance frameworks, and audit expectations.
- Continuous improvement and digital transformation in HAZOP practices.
- Capstone: Developing a roadmap for HAZOP excellence in your organization.
